Farah is a multi-award-winning director and editor, fueled by a lifelong passion for filmmaking.
She began her journey at just 9 years old, experimenting with her father’s VHS camera and editing footage on two VCRs. By 19, she had learned to edit on an Avid and was accepted into the prestigious USC Film Production Program. While still an undergraduate, she honed her skills editing student films and directing music videos and short films.
Before transitioning fully into filmmaking, Farah had a brief stint in modeling, gaining experience in front of the camera. Her talent behind the camera earned her an opportunity to work with legendary director Clive Barker at just 20 years old.
After graduating from USC with honors in 2000, Farah’s star continued to rise. She worked closely with Mariah Carey, directing multiple projects and becoming her personal editor. She also collaborated with Prince at Paisley Park and in Los Angeles. Her work led Billboard to name her one of the top ten up-and-coming directors.
Farah’s directorial projects have made waves in the industry, including her first feature-length documentary The Remix: Hip Hop x Fashion, which premiered at Tribeca Film Festival 2019 and won numerous Best Documentary awards before being acquired by Netflix. She also directed the critically acclaimed online docu-series SeeHer: Multiplicity, which earned a Gracie award, Shorty Audience Award, and Gold and Silver Telly Awards.
Her work has continued to expand, including an episode of the Hulu original Rap Caviar Presents and the short documentary Mamba’s Murals for the Sports Explains the World series, which premiered at Tribeca in 2023. Farah also collaborated with Beyoncé on Renaissance: A Film by Beyoncé.
Most recently, Farah directed the documentary for Stray Kids: The Dominate Experience film, which debuted as the number one film globally on its opening weekend and made history as the first K-pop concert film to ever reach #1 at the box office.
She calls Brooklyn, NY home.
